MTV Bleeps File Sharing Software Out Of Music Videos:
MTV’s new video hosting site is apparently bleeping out the names of file sharing sites in Weird Al Yankovic’s famous 2006 song “Don’t Download This Song.” The opening verse to the song goes as follows:

Too Legit to Quit (1991)
After dropping the “MC” from his stage name, Burrell released Too Legit to Quit (again, produced by Felton Pilate) in 1991. Burrell took the opportunity to answer his critics on certain songs on the album. Though the album was, by and large, no better accepted (critically) than his first, sales were strong (over three-million copies) and the title track was a hit. Another hit came soon...

Sonic Youth Live at Battery Park - July 4, 2008 →
perpetua:
WFMU has archived a top-notch recording of Sonic Youth’s excellent free concert at Battery Park earlier this year. It’s a great show covering a lot of classics, including “Schizophrenia,” “100%,” “Bull in the Heather,” “Skip Tracer,” “Jams Run Free,” and about half of Daydream Nation.
